Abstract:

The research project "BIODIE2 ŽTechnologies for second generation biodiesel production from lignoŽcellulosic biomass", sponsored by Italian Ministry for Agriculture and Forestry, aims at developing an experimental prototype for biomass gasification and FischerŽTropsch synthesis for biodiesel production. During the research project several typologies of solid residual and dedicated biomass will be tested. The paper focuses on FischerŽTropsch reactor design and building. The chosen layout, the monitoring system, the safety system, the structure of the reactor, the piping section (flow inversion in the reactor), the temperature control system and the storage tank will be described. The size of the chosen system is larger than laboratory systems found in literature, in order to scaleŽup the experimentations to industrial conditions, but, at the same time, maintaining the system versatility of a laboratory scale system. The first tests were carried out using H2/CO bottles with a H2/CO ratio of 0.67. Gas mixture, collected inside the storage tank, has been analysed by gaschromatograph to verify composition and to have information about reaction selectivity. The paper shows the preliminary tests and results collected, that will be preparatory to the syngas cleaning system building in order to start the whole BTL experimentation.
